Layered structure and magnetic and magneto-optical properties of Co/Au and Fe/Au compositionally modulated multilayered films (CMF's) prepared by RF sputtering method were investigated. Modulation length (D) varied from about 10 Å to more than 100 Å. Many satellite peaks were observed in high angle diffraction patterns of the both multilayered films. It was found that the values of magneto-optical Kerr rotation (θK) are low and the spectra is simple if the case of relatively small D, however, a new peak of θK appears at around λ = 500 nm, corresponding to the absorption edge of Au metal, with the increase of D. Moreover, it was also found that perpendicular anisotropy (Ku) is induced gradually with decreasing D in both CMF's. Perticularly, Ku of Co/Au CMF's becomes positive in the range of relatively large D.
